The utility model relates to a seeding mechanism of a seeder, which comprises a frame, the upper part of which is sequentially connected with a four-bar linkage mechanism and a strong seeding metering device. A seed metering wheel is arranged in the strong seeding metering device, the seed metering wheel is installed on the seed metering shaft, the first sprocket is installed on the seed metering shaft, the bottom of the four-bar linkage mechanism is provided with a second sprocket, and the second sprocket is connected with the first sprocket through a chain. The upper end of the bar linkage mechanism is articulated to one side of the seed box, and the other side of the seed box is connected with the rack. The lower part of the rack is provided with stubble breaking discs, trenching discs, depth limiting wheels, compacting wheels and compacting wheels, which are installed at the lower part of the rack. The compacting wheels are connected with the rack through a cantilever. The depth limiting wheels are connected to the outer side of the lower part of the rack, and the trenching discs are located directly below the strong-impact seed metering device. The stubble disc is connected to the lower end of the frame. Deep-limiting wheel can ensure synchronization with the seed-throwing point, compacting wheel can press seeds into wet soil, and compactor can crush soil blocks. Compression after sowing is conducive to promoting seed germination.

技术介绍
播种机是利用机械化、自动流水线,将种子点播在预制的型孔式的水平盘内,然后在开沟器开完沟,由肥箱施肥后,经导种管把种子排到沟里。它排种率高、周边型孔对种子粒型的适应性比较好。采用此播种机技术播出的种子,出苗整齐、便于机械化生产。但是现有的播种机播种的深度不同,且不能保证种子与土壤的紧密接触,最后的镇压效果不好,导致种子发芽率不高。

1.一种播种机的播种机构,包括机架,其特征在于:所述机架上部依次连接有四杆联动机构和强击式排种器,所述强击式排种器内设置有排种轮,所述排种轮安装在排种轴上,所述排种轴上安装有第一链轮,所述四杆联动机构的底部设有第二链轮,所述第二链轮与第一链轮通过链条连接,四杆联动机构的上端铰接至种箱的一侧,所述种箱的另一侧与机架连接,机架下部设置有破茬圆盘、开沟圆盘、限深轮、压实轮和镇压轮,所述镇压轮安装在机架最前端下部,所述压实轮通过悬臂与机架连接,所述限深轮连接在机架下部外侧,所述开沟圆盘位于强击式排种器的正下方,所述破茬圆盘通过连杆连接在机架最后端下部。
